Why is it called Kardashian Salad?

This viral La Scala Salad has actually been around since the 1950s! It was created by Jean Leon, the owner of La Scala, a famous Beverly Hills restaurant known for its Italian chopped salad. La Scala Salad Ingredients

Lettuce: The combination of romaine and iceberg lettuce adds a crisp texture to this salad.

Salami: I buy hard salami sold in a log. It has a firmer texture and big, bold flavor! Deli salami also works!

Add More Veggies: You could add artichoke hearts, sliced bell peppers, tomatoes, or cucumbers. The sky is the limit!

Romano Cheese: The added cheese in the dressing is next level! Feel free to use Parmesan cheese if you prefer.

Red Pepper Flakes: Optional, but gives it a yummy kick of flavor!

More Protein Options: Add more protein to make this salad a meal. Try grilled chicken breast, steak, salmon, or pepperoni.

Make it Vegetarian: Leave out the salami and add more veggies to make this a vegetarian friendly salad.

How to Make La Scala Salad

Super quick and easy, this famous salad is perfect as a side or even a light main dish. It comes together fast and always impresses with its fresh, vibrant flavors. Try my Grinder Salad or Grinder Sliders, for the same flavors!

Make the Dressing: In a medium bowl, add the olive oil, red wine vinegar, Dijon mustard, salt, pepper, red pepper flakes, and grated Romano cheese. Whisk until combined.

Mix the Salad Ingredients: In a large bowl, add the chopped lettuce, chickpeas, salami, red onion, and shredded mozzarella cheese. Pour the dressing over the salad ingredients and then gently toss to combine. Top La Scala salad with additional Romano cheese and red pepper flakes. Then serve immediately and enjoy!

Ingredients

Salad

3 cups Romaine lettuce, chopped 2 cups iceberg lettuce, chopped1 (15-ounce) chickpeas, drained and rinsed6 ounces sliced Italian salami, or chopped cups shredded mozzarella cheese¼ cup sliced red onion

Dressing

½ cup olive oil¼ cup red wine vinegar1 tablespoon Dijon mustard½ teaspoon Kosher salt½ teaspoon cracked black pepper¼ cup grated Romano or parmesan cheesered pepper flakes, optional

Instructions

Salad

In a large bowl, add 2 cups iceberg lettuce, 3 cups Romaine lettuce, 1 (15-ounce) chickpeas, 6 ounces sliced Italian salami, ¼ cup sliced red onion and 1¼ cups shredded mozzarella cheese.
In a small bowl, add ½ cup olive oil, ¼ cup red wine vinegar, 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ard, ½ teaspoon Kosher salt, ½ teaspoon cracked black pepper, red pepper flakes, and ¼ cup grated Romano or parmesan cheese. Whisk together until combined.
Pour the dressing over the salad ingredients and gently toss to combine.
Top with additional Romano cheese and red pepper flakes. Serve immediately and enjoy!

Notes

Leftovers and Make Ahead Instructions: Store the salad and dressing separately for the best texture. Once tossed, the lettuce will soften, so it’s best enjoyed right away. To make it ahead, chop the ingredients and mix the dressing in advance, then toss everything together just before serving.
